I had been looking for a dog for a while before I found unleashed and my current dog. It felt more friendly and offbeat than most shelters. I really liked it. They have a different process, you apply when you enter, its short. One page. No nonsense. They take care of the paperwork first. You get a private room and a friendly counselor comes in and helps u find a good fit. They liken it to wedding dress shopping. It avoids awkward oggling against cage walls, reduces stress for the dogs, and really opens you up. You think about what your really looking for. The dog I was interested in turned out to be like, feral, and we discussed other dogs. My restrictions were: good with kids, a hiking partner, young and trainable. They pulled a couple dogs for me and brought them in, with treats and toys. They really are looking to put dogs in good homes that work and make the process as straightforward as possible. They are very open and non judgemental about adoption and dog ownership. If anything doesn't work out, they made it clear how easy it was to bring the dog back. You sign an adoption contract agreeing to treat the dog as an indoor pet and care for it. As far as the cost goes, I was presented the total of the medical treatments my dog received-- $375-- and asked for a donation. I paid $250 for my dog, which seemed a fair price to me. I wish I could have paid the total but was nervous about the new costs I would incur as a pet owner. I will likely donate again to them in the future. For those interested in puppies, most are in foster and you may need to set up a time to meet outside the shelter. Happy to have skipped housebreaking!!
